In the ancient history of China, the love story between Tang Xuanzong and Yang Guifei is widely circulated, but this relationship ended in tragedy. In 756 AD, during the An Lushan Rebellion, an event called the "Ma Wei Coup" changed the fate of the Tang Dynasty and led to the tragic death of Yang Guifei. This article will explore how Chen Xuanli launched the Ma Wei Coup and analyze its impact on the political situation at that time.

I. Background of Chen Xuanli and the Ma Wei Coup

Chen Xuanli was an eunuch during the reign of Tang Xuanzong, who held considerable power in the court. After the outbreak of the An Lushan Rebellion, as the rebel army approached Chang'an, the court fell into chaos. Chen Xuanli, along with other eunuchs and generals, advocated fleeing west to Sichuan to avoid the war. In this process, they used the soldiers and civilians' dissatisfaction with Yang Guifei's relative Yang Guozhong and his cronyism to launch a coup.

II. The Course of the Ma Wei Coup

The Ma Wei Coup occurred at Ma Wei Post (now Ma Wei Town, Xingping City, Xianyang City, Shaanxi Province) on Tang Xuanzong's westward escape route. Under Chen Xuanli's planning, the soldiers rebelled and demanded the execution of Yang Guozhong. After Yang Guozhong was killed, the soldiers further demanded the execution of Yang Guifei, believing that she was the root of the country's disaster. Facing strong pressure, Tang Xuanzong had no choice but to order Yang Guifei to commit suicide.

III. The Impact of the Ma Wei Coup

The death of Yang Guifei marked the decline of Tang Xuanzong's power. This coup not only ended a legendary love story but also exposed the contradictions and corruption within the Tang court. After the Ma Wei Coup, although Tang Xuanzong continued to be in exile, he had lost his true political influence. Chen Xuanli, on the other hand, played an important role in the subsequent power vacuum, supporting Tang Suzong to ascend the throne and becoming a close advisor to the new emperor.
